Programme Overview
The Professional Certificate in Introduction to Axiomatic Set Theory is designed for mathematicians, computer scientists, and philosophers aiming to deepen their foundational understanding of set theory. This comprehensive programme provides a rigorous exploration of Zermelo-Fraenkel set theory with the Axiom of Choice (ZFC), including the logical structure, axioms, and theorems that underpin modern mathematics. Learners will engage with advanced topics such as cardinal and ordinal numbers, transfinite recursion, and the continuum hypothesis, equipping them with the necessary tools to apply set-theoretic concepts in various fields.

Topics Covered
- Introduction to Set Theory: Introduces the basic concepts and historical development of set theory.: Set Operations: Covers union, intersection, complement, and Cartesian products.
- Relations and Functions: Discusses binary relations, equivalence relations, and function properties.: Cardinality: Explores the concept of infinity and different sizes of infinity.
- Axiomatic Foundations: Introduces Zermelo-Fraenkel axioms and the role of the Axiom of Choice.: Ordinal Numbers: Examines the concept of order types and transfinite induction.
